Why players search for Free Teen Patti chips
Teen Patti is social and fast-paced: a few bad hands can wipe out your stack. Free chips reduce friction — they give you a chance to learn strategies, enter tournaments, and enjoy the social side without the pressure of real money. From a product perspective, free chips are also how developers onboard new users, keep veterans engaged, and fuel tournament participation.

Common legitimate sources
- Welcome bonuses for new accounts (claimable on sign-up).
- Daily login rewards and streak bonuses.
- Referral programs: invite friends and both accounts receive chips.
- Watching in-app ads or completing short offerwalls (platform‑managed).
- Tournament entry prizes and leaderboard payouts.
- Seasonal events, holiday giveaways, and special community promos.

Strategies to make free chips last
Getting free chips is only half the battle — preserving them is the other. Here are practical strategies I picked up from seasoned players and my own sessions:
- Play tight early: fold marginal hands until you’ve rebuilt a modest buffer.
- Bankroll in brackets: treat your chips as separate pots (eg. casual play vs. tournament buy‑ins).
- Avoid high‑variance tables when relying on free chips; choose tables with players who show predictable patterns.
- Use small, frequent buy‑ins to practice strategy rather than large gambles.
- Redeem bonuses strategically: some timed promos are more valuable when stacked.

Watching ads and third‑party offers — what to watch for
Watching ads can deliver steady small amounts of chips, but not all ad or offer walls are worth the time. Always confirm an offer is integrated within the official client or promoted on the verified promotions page. Avoid downloading apps or completing tasks that ask for unnecessary personal data. If an offer looks too intrusive or requires payment to unlock the “free” chips, steer clear.

Security and legitimacy: how to avoid scams
Protecting your account and personal information should be a priority. Here are signs of legitimate offers and red flags for scams:
- Legitimate: visible in‑app promotions, official push notifications, or entries on the platform’s verified web pages.
- Red flag: offers sent via unsolicited email asking for passwords or requesting external login credentials.
- Red flag: shortcuts promising unlimited chips in exchange for downloads outside the app store.
- Tip: enable two‑factor authentication if available and never share account details.
Troubleshooting common issues
Sometimes chips don’t appear immediately. Here’s how to troubleshoot:
- Check the promotions or transaction history to confirm the claim went through.
- Restart the app and ensure you’re on the latest version; some credits apply on next login.
- Clear cache or reinstall if the client behaves oddly (note: backing up account info is recommended before reinstall).
- Contact official customer support with screenshots — reputable platforms have responsive support channels.

Frequently Asked Questions
Are free chips the same as real money?
No. Free chips are in‑game currency used for social play and tournaments. They typically cannot be cashed out. Understand the terms before you chase an offer.
Can I get unlimited free chips?
No platform sustainably offers unlimited free chips. Expect daily caps, cooldowns, and terms that limit repeat claims. Strategically combining different legitimate channels yields the best results.
What if my free chips don’t show up?
First, check your transaction history and account level. If they’re missing, contact official support with your account ID and screenshots. Keep a polite, detailed description to speed resolution.
Is it safe to use external cheat tools that promise chips?
Never use cheats or hacks. They violate platform rules, risk account bans, and often lead to scams. Stick to sanctioned channels.
